Font Pairing and Readability Considerations
Driveway works best when paired with complementary fonts that enhance its character without competing for attention. A common pairing is to use a display font like Driveway for headings and a serif font such as Georgia or Times New Roman for body copy. This combination ensures that the content remains easy to read while still feeling visually engaging.
For captions, navigation menus, and footnotes, a clean sans serif font like Helvetica or Arial complements Driveway well. These pairings help establish a clear visual hierarchy, guiding the reader through the content effortlessly.
When selecting font styles, check if the font includes alternates, ligatures, and multilingual support. While Driveway is primarily designed for English text, it's always good to confirm whether it supports other languages if your audience requires it.
